Manual Power Generator
One of the most interesting elements is the
hand-crank power module
, which helps demonstrate that energy can be generated through movement.
By turning the crank, the child can power a correctly connected circuit and observe how selected modules operate. It is an engaging way to introduce the relationship between movement, energy and the operation of electrical devices.

Light Sensor
The
photosensitive module
allows children to build circuits that react to changes in light intensity. It shows that an electronic circuit does not always have to be activated by pressing a button – it can also respond to its surroundings.
This is an interesting introduction to the principles behind sensors used in many everyday devices.

No Soldering Required
The elements are designed as separate, colorful modules. They are connected using the included cables and can be arranged on three construction boards.
There is no need to solder any components. Once one experiment is finished, the circuit can be disconnected and the same parts can be used to build something completely different.
Learning Through Experimentation
The set encourages children to explore cause-and-effect relationships. In order for a construction to work, the components must be connected correctly. If the result is different from expected, the child can look for the cause and adjust the circuit.
